Output 5c6bd2fdaaff59886ab351ebe133b655a6f214dc23d470f53c9c659f57c52e2d:0

value
990222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ac7801a22d87cb5e74b9ef1b16ccf052ea225a OP_EQUAL
address
3CEeEwkcb3GQtZP2Y7GMYCwrokMkWNh2W2
transaction
5c6bd2fdaaff59886ab351ebe133b655a6f214dc23d470f53c9c659f57c52e2d
confirmations
350957
spent
true